Corn Pudding With Fresh Basil
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 0 Minutes
Cook Time: 60 Minutes
Ready In: 60 Minutes
Servings: 8
This is one of my favorite sides for the summer. You can use canned corn but it's sooooo much better with fresh.
Ingredients:
4 cups corn (approx. 6 ears)
1 cup packed fresh basil leaves, torn
3 t all purpose flour
1 t sugar
1 cup milk
1 cup heavy cream
4 large eggs, lightly beaten
1/4 t. salt
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ees with rack in middle.
2. Butter 2 1/2 quart shallow baking dish.
3. Pulse 1/2 of the corn in a food processor or blender till coarsely chopped.
4. Transfer to large bowl and stir in basil, flour, remaining corn and 1/4 t. of salt.
5. Whisk milk, cream and eggs together and add to corn mixture until combined.
6. Pour into prepared baking dish and bake 45 mins. to 1 hour until center is just set.
7. Let stand 15 minutes before serving.
